Marin Journal
Thursday, December 25, 1941
Page 1
Alto Death Trap Claims Life of William G. Clerc
William G. H. Clerc, 59 year old resident of Alto, was killed Tuesday evening about 5:30 as he attempted to drive his car across the highway and was hit by a south bound truck driven by Angelo Costo of Healdsburg.
Clerc, according to Coroner Keaton, was moving west from the Tiburon road to the Mill Valley highway when he met his death. Responsibility for the accident has not been fixed.
Mr. Clerc, a distiller, had been in the employ of the Mason Distillery for many years. He is a native of England, and had lived in this county for about forty years.
He leaves his wife, Mrs. Amy Clerc; two daughters – Mrs. May Keegan of San Anselmo and Mrs. Beatrice Sokolik, residing at Alto. A son, Stanley, passed away some years ago.
Funeral service will be held Friday afternoon from the Russell Funeral Parlor, Mill Valley, followed by interment in Mt. View Cemetery, Oakland.
